Why Are Workers' Compensation Claims Denied in Orlando?
There are many reasons why a workers' compensation claim in Florida might be denied, but some of the most common include:
01
Failure to Report the Injury on Time
In Florida, you must report your injury within 30 days of the incident. Missing this window can result in an automatic denial.
02
Insufficient Medical Evidence
If there’s not enough documentation to prove your injury is work-related, your claim may be rejected. More detailed medical records are often needed to strengthen your case.
03
Pre-Existing Conditions
If an injury aggravates an existing condition, insurance companies may deny the claim, arguing that the workplace accident wasn’t the main cause.
04
Disputes Over Causation
Sometimes, employers or their insurance providers will dispute that the injury happened at work, which can result in a denied claim.
05
Failure to Follow Treatment Plans
If you don’t follow your doctor's treatment plan, the insurance company may argue that you delayed or worsened your recovery, leading to a denial.
06
Failure to Meet the Legal Definition of Injury or Illness
Not all conditions are covered under Florida workers’ compensation. Injuries caused by intoxication, self-inflicted harm, or certain mental health issues may be excluded.
What Steps Should You Take If Your Workers’ Compensation Claim Was Denied in Orlando, Florida?
When Florida law gives injured workers the right to challenge insurance company denial decisions through a structured appeals process. Here’s what that process typically looks like:
1. Get the Denial in Writing
The insurance company must provide a written notice explaining why your claim was denied. This document is crucial, as it outlines the reasons for the denial and provides guidance on the next steps in building your appeal. Our denied workers’ compensation claim attorneys can carefully review this document to identify the insurer’s arguments and begin planning your response.
2. File a Petition for Benefits
If you disagree with the denial, the next step is to file a Petition for Benefits with the Office of Judges of Compensation Claims (OJCC). This petition must be filed within two years of the accident or the last benefit payment, whichever is later. The petition outlines the benefits you are seeking and explains why the denial should be overturned. An Orlando denied workers’ compensation claims lawyer at Van Dingenen Law ensures your petition is drafted correctly, supported with strong documentation, and filed on time, giving you the best chance of success in mediation or at a hearing.
3. Mediation Conference
Most cases go to mediation first, where a neutral mediator works with you and the insurer to try to resolve the dispute. Mediation is an informal process designed to facilitate a voluntary settlement without the need for a formal hearing. Your denied workers’ compensation claims lawyer can represent you, present your case to the mediator, and work to secure a fair settlement without unnecessary delays.
4. Hearing Before a Judge of Compensation Claims (JCC)
If mediation doesn’t resolve the case, it moves to a formal hearing before a JCC. Both sides present evidence, including medical reports, witness testimony, and expert opinions. Your Orlando denied workers’ compensation claim lawyer will gather medical records, witness testimony, and expert opinions to present before the judge, ensuring your side of the story is fully documented. The judge then issues a ruling on whether benefits should be awarded.
5. Appeal to the First District Court of Appeal
If either side disagrees with the JCC’s decision, the ruling can be appealed to the Florida First District Court of Appeal. This court reviews the case for legal errors and may uphold, reverse, or remand the case for further proceedings. Your denied workers’ compensation claim attorney in Orlando will handle the appeal, challenging legal errors and pushing for a reversal or a new hearing.

What Is the Deadline for Appealing a Denied Workers’ Compensation Claim in Orlando?
In Florida, strict deadlines apply to workers’ compensation appeals. To challenge a denial, you must file a
Petition for Benefits with the Office of the Judges of Compensation Claims (OJCC) within
two years of the date of your injury or
within one year of your last authorized medical treatment or wage-loss payment, whichever is later. Missing this deadline will almost always bar you from recovering benefits. How soon will I get a decision on my workers’ compensation appeal in Orlando?
The timeline varies depending on whether your case settles in mediation or proceeds to a full hearing before a Judge of Compensation Claims (JCC). Mediation can resolve disputes in a matter of weeks, while hearings may take several months. What happens if the Judge of Compensation Claims upholds my workers’ comp claim denial?
If the JCC rules against you, you still have the right to appeal to the Florida First District Court of Appeal. This higher court reviews legal errors in your case and can reverse the denial or send it back for reconsideration.
